The problem with Nissan right now is that their portfolio is a mess. Lease to Retail for NMAC is 25% retail 75% Lease. Most healthy compaines rund a 48/52 or 50/50. So how do you correct this, you make the Money Factor's on a Lease really high. .00350+ and you make the residual low 50-55%. This will encourage you to purchase and they can correct thier portfolio. Only problem is that NMAC may lose some sales over this. But I hope the Z is worth more than 55% in 2-3 years. Just My.02

At the end of lease you will have paid $31,776, which is more than I paid to buy my car. If you had put down $6000 more you could have kept the same payments and would have owned the car at the end of 4 years giving you trade equity, instead you have to give it back.
